// FEED_VALIDATION_TIMEOUT_MS controls how long the Castwick validator
// waits on a remote podcast feed before marking it unreachable. Do not
// lower this below 8000: several large Norlund-hosted feeds legitimately
// take 6-7 seconds to stream their full episode list, and premature
// timeouts trigger false alerts for on-call. If you must tune it, test
// against the slow-feed fixture and record the validating build's token below.

session token of tajef-bageg = htk21_5d90d574934f3ccae6437

Handover note — Crumbwheel order cutoffs.

Welcome aboard. The bakery cutoff rule in Crumbwheel closes same-day orders at 14:00 local to each storefront, not UTC — this has bitten us twice. Holiday overrides live in the calendar service and take precedence silently, so always check there first when a cutoff looks wrong. To unlock the calendar service's admin console after a restart, enter the recovery passphrase below.

vault phrase of bagap-bahaf = silion-pelox-sorox-casdor-quenwyn-fraax-eliox-praael-kelion-quenvan-kasox-rusael-norius-belvan

Splitting the user module out of the Hollowgate monolith: extract auth, profile, and preferences into the new Wrenfold service, strangler-style. Keep the shim in place until traffic hits zero on legacy routes. Migration scripts are idempotent; run them in order. The cutover credentials are stored in an encrypted archive alongside the runbook. Future maintainers should unlock that archive with the recovery passphrase that appears directly below this note.

unlock words, hahip-yagef: zorok-novmir-zorix-silax

**CI note: timezone weirdness in report exports**

Heads up, support folks — if a customer says their Ledgerpine export shows times shifted by a few hours, it's probably the CI image. The export workers got rebuilt last week and the base image defaults to UTC, while older workers used the account's locale. Fix is rolling out; meanwhile tell customers the data itself is fine, just the display offset. Affected exports carry the build token shown below.

build token for bajof-tahop: htk4_a981